What is a Folding Mobility Scooter?
A folding mobility scooter is a compact electric vehicle developed to help people with mobility difficulties in preserving their self-reliance. These scooters can be easily collapsed for transportation, making them ideal for traveling and browsing different environments. They supply an option that integrates mobility with benefit, enhancing the user experience for seniors who might have restricted physical capabilities.
Benefits of Folding Mobility Scooters
Folding mobility scooters provide various benefits to seniors, consisting of:

Enhanced Independence: Seniors can easily move their community or participate in social activities without counting on others for transport.

Mobility: The capability to fold the scooter enables it to fit in the trunk of an automobile, making it simple to take on journeys or family trips.

Lightweight Design: Many folding scooters are created to be lightweight, making them simple to deal with for seniors who may have a hard time with heavier designs.

Adjustable Features: Many designs supply adjustable seats, armrests, and heights to accommodate different user requirements.

Security and Comfort: With durable designs, comfy seating, and smooth operation, these scooters focus on user safety and convenience.
Key Features to Consider
When picking a folding mobility scooter, numerous functions ought to be thought about to guarantee a comfy and safe experience:
FeatureDescriptionWeight CapacityVarious models support various weight capabilities. Think about the user’s weight when choosing a scooter.Battery LifeLook for scooters with long-lasting batteries for extended use. Many models are created for 10-15 miles of travel per charge.SpeedMost scooters have a speed variety of 3-8 mph.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are folding mobility scooters simple to operate?

Yes, many folding mobility scooters are designed with user-friendliness in mind. They generally feature simple throttle control and steering mechanisms, making them accessible for seniors with differing levels of experience.

2. Is insurance coverage or Medicare coverage readily available for mobility scooters?

Sometimes, Medicare might cover part of the cost of a mobility scooter if it is considered clinically essential. Consult the healthcare supplier and insurance business for specific guidelines and eligibility criteria.

3. How do I keep my folding mobility scooter?

Routine upkeep for mobility scooters includes checking tire pressure, keeping the battery charged, and cleaning the scooter regularly. It’s likewise suggested to seek advice from the user manual for specific upkeep instructions suggested by the maker.

4. Can folding scooters manage outdoor terrain?

Lots of folding mobility scooters are designed for both indoor and outside usage. However, seniors must inspect the specs to make sure that the model they pick can manage differing surfaces if they plan to utilize it outdoors.
